摘要:

文题释义:
阳和汤:源自清代王洪绪《外科证治全生集》,全方由熟地、鹿角胶、肉桂、炮姜碳、麻黄、白芥子、生甘草组成,具有温阳养血化痰、散寒通滞的功效,主治阳虚寒凝证。
骨关节炎:是一种以关节软骨退行性变和继发性骨质增生为特征的慢性关节疾病,主要症状包括关节疼痛、活动受限和关节畸形等,又称退行性关节炎。

背景:阳和汤是临床治疗膝骨关节炎的有效方药,前期基础研究表明阳和汤防治骨关节炎的机制与其对关节软骨的保护有关,阳和汤对膝骨关节炎早期滑膜炎症的影响尚未明确。
目的:探讨阳和汤对早期膝骨关节炎模型兔滑膜炎症的影响,进一步明确阳和汤治疗早期骨关节炎的疗效及作用机制。
方法:将24只4月龄新西兰兔随机分为空白对照组、模型组、阳和汤组和阳性对照组,每组6只。除空白对照组外,其余各组予关节腔注射木瓜蛋白酶造模。造模2周后,空白对照组和模型组给予等量生理盐水灌胃,阳和汤组给予6 g/(kg•d)阳和汤灌胃,阳性对照组给予24 mg/(kg•d)塞来昔布药物灌胃,连续给药2周。最后一次给药后4 h,测量膝关节局部皮温、关节周径,Lequesne评分评估膝关节功能;最后一次灌胃结束后第2天,ELISA法检测关节液中白细胞介素1β、肿瘤坏死因子α、环氧化酶2、前列腺素E2水平;苏木精-伊红染色观察滑膜组织形态;免疫组织化学染色观察滑膜组织中白细胞介素1β、肿瘤坏死因子α、环氧化酶2蛋白表达。
结果与结论:①与空白对照组比较,模型组膝关节周径增宽(P < 0.05),局部皮温、Lequesne评分及关节液中白细胞介素1β、肿瘤坏死因子α、环氧化酶2、前列腺素E2水平均升高(P < 0.05),滑膜形态学炎性改变明显,滑膜组织中白细胞介素1β、肿瘤坏死因子α、环氧化酶2蛋白表达均升高(P < 0.05);②与模型组比较,阳和汤组和阳性对照组膝关节周径减小(P < 0.05),局部皮温、Lequesne评分及关节液中肿瘤坏死因子α、白细胞介素1β、环氧化酶2、前列腺素E2水平均降低(P < 0.05),滑膜炎性改变减轻,滑膜组织中白细胞介素1β、肿瘤坏死因子α、环氧化酶2蛋白表达均降低(P < 0.05);③结果表明,阳和汤能抑制早期膝骨关节炎模型兔关节液和滑膜组织中肿瘤坏死因子α、白细胞介素1β、环氧化酶2、前列腺素E2的表达,减轻滑膜炎症,改善关节功能,从而延缓膝骨关节炎的进展。

Abstract: BACKGROUND: Yanghe Decoction is an effective prescription for the clinical treatment of knee osteoarthritis. Our previous basic studies have shown that the mechanism of Yanghe Decoction to prevent and treat knee osteoarthritis is related to the protection of articular cartilage. It is still not unclear about the effect of Yanghe Decoction on early synovial inflammation of knee osteoarthritis. 
OBJECTIVE: To investigate the effect of Yanghe Decoction on the pain and synovial inflammation in a rabbit model of early knee osteoarthritis, and to further clarify the efficacy and mechanism of Yanghe Decoction in the treatment of early osteoarthritis.
METHODS: Twenty-four 4-month-old New Zealand rabbits were randomly divided into blank control group, model group, Yanghe Decoction group and positive control group, with six rabbits in each group. Except for the blank control group, the rabbits in the other groups were injected with papain into the joint cavity for modeling. Two weeks after modeling, the blank control and model groups were given the same amount of normal saline by gavage, the Yanghe Decoction group was given 6 g/kg/d Yanghe Decoction, and the positive control group was given 24 mg/kg/d Celebrex. Administration in each group lasted for 2 weeks. At 4 hours after final administration, the knee joint skin temperature and circumference were measured, and Lequesne MG score was used to evaluate knee joint function. At 2 days after final intragastric administration, ELISA was used to detect the levels of interleukin-1β, tumor necrosis factor-α, cyclooxygenase-2, and prostaglandin E2 in the synovial fluid. Synovial tissue morphology was observed using hematoxylin-eosin staining. Immunohistochemical detection was conducted to detect the expression of interleukin-1β, tumor necrosis factor-α, cyclooxygenase-2 proteins in synovial tissue. 
RESULTS AND CONCLUSION: Compared with the blank control group, the knee joint circumference in the model group was widened (P < 0.05), and the local skin temperature, Lequesne MG score, and the levels of interleukin-1β, tumor necrosis factor-α, cyclooxygenase-2, and prostaglandin E2 in the synovial fluid were all increased (P < 0.05), synovial membrane morphology and inflammatory changes were obvious, and the expressions of interleukin-1β, tumor necrosis factor-α, cyclooxygenase-2 proteins in synovial tissue were all increased (P < 0.05). Compared with the model group, the knee joint circumference in the Yanghe Decoction group and positive control group decreased (P < 0.05), local skin temperature, Lequesne MG score, and the levels of interleukin-1β, tumor necrosis factor-α, cyclooxygenase-2, and prostaglandin E2 in the synovial fluid were all decreased (P < 0.05), synovial membrane morphology and inflammatory changes were alleviated, and the expressions of interleukin-1β, tumor necrosis factor-α, cyclooxygenase-2 proteins in synovial tissue were all downregulated (P < 0.05). In conclusion, Yanghe Decoction can inhibit the expression of interleukin-1β, tumor necrosis factor-α, cyclooxygenase-2, and prostaglandin E2, reduce synovial inflammation, and improve joint function, thereby delaying the progression of knee osteoarthritis.
